1. MetaTrader 4
MetaTrader 4 is one of the most popular Forex trading platforms in the world, and its Android app allows traders to access their accounts and trade on the go. The app provides real-time quotes, advanced charting tools, and a wide range of technical indicators. Traders can also place and manage their trades directly from the app, making it a convenient and powerful tool for Forex trading.
2. eToro
eToro is a social trading platform that allows users to copy trades from successful traders. The eToro Android app provides access to the platform's features, including the ability to view and copy other traders' portfolios, trade on the go, and access real-time market data. The app also offers a range of educational resources, making it suitable for both beginner and experienced traders.
